Why visit Kuala Lumpur?
Kuala Lumpur is a dynamic capital where gleaming skyscrapers rise above leafy parks and heritage districts. You will find a welcoming city that blends old-world charm with modern convenience, from iconic towers to vibrant street life and green spaces.
What to expect
The city revolves around districts like KLCC, Bukit Bintang, and Chinatown, each with a distinct character. Expect efficient public transport, air-conditioned malls, lively markets, and a relaxed pace that makes it easy to explore, linger in cafés, and enjoy the skyline after dark.
Plan your trip
Kuala Lumpur works well as both a short city break and a base for exploring the rest of Malaysia. Its well-connected rail and road links make it a natural gateway to nearby hills, coastal destinations, and other cities, so you can combine urban discoveries with wider adventures.
